The Hexadecimal Color #665BDA is a contrast shade of Slate Blue. #665BDA RGB value is rgb(102, 91, 218). RGB Color Model of #665BDA consists of 40% red, 35% green and 85% blue. HSL color Mode of #665BDA has 245°(degrees) Hue, 63% Saturation and 61% Lightness. #665BDA color has an wavelength of 465.74074n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#665BDA is #9966FF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#665BDA is #65D. The Closest Color to #665BDA is #6A5ACD. Official Name of #665BDA Hex Code is Fuchsia Blue.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#665BDA is 53 Cyan 58 Magenta 0 Yellow 15 Black and #665BDA CMY is 53, 58,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#665BDA is hsl(245,63,61,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(245, 58, 85).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#665BDA is 21.87, 15.37, 68.13.
Hex8 Value of #665BDA is #665BDAFF. Decimal Value of #665BDA is 6708186 and Octal Value of #665BDA is 31455732. Binary Value of #665BDA is 1100110, 1011011, 11011010 and Android of #665BDA is 4284898266 / 0xff665bda.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#665BDA is 0.208, 0.146, 0.146 and YIQ Color Space of #665BDA is 108.767, -34.2502, 41.8489.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#665BDA is 11.56, 11.12, 67.27.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#665BDA is 46.14, 38.56, -63.93.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#665BDA is 46.14, -3.8, -99.28.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#665BDA is 46.14, 74.66, 301.1. Hunter Lab variable of #665BDA is 39.2, 30.97, -75.59.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#665BDA

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
